Fablehaven is a fantasy book series for children written by Brandon Mull. [1] The book series, which includes Fablehaven, Fablehaven: Rise of the Evening Star, Fablehaven: Grip of the Shadow Plague, Fablehaven: Secrets of the Dragon Sanctuary and Fablehaven: Keys to the Demon Prison, is published by Shadow Mountain in hardcover and Simon & Schuster in paperback.
The Dark Is Rising Sequence is a series of five contemporary fantasy novels for older children and young adults that were written by the British author Susan Cooper and published from 1965 to 1977. [3] [4] A market for children's fantasy was established in Britain in the 19th century, [5] leading to works such as Lewis Carroll's Alice in Wonderland and Edith Nesbit's Five Children series; [6] the genre also developed in America, exemplified by L. Frank Baum's The Wonderful Wizard of Oz. [7]
